The Louise, Beckons
10/10 Excellent
"The Louise is a destination in itself with it's scenic outlook and all-inclusiveness. Everything from breakfast, your mini-bar (everyday), afternoon appetisers, pre-drinks (including cocktails and top shelf spirits) then decadent four-course dinners with matching wines are included. Every night (in winter) turn down service included herbal night teas and hot water bottles left in the bed. Had we been here in summer, we would of made use of the infinity pool overlooking the vineyards. Being our first time in The Barossa we chose to use it as our "hub" to explore the many wineries from - including Tscharke which is literally across the road. The Underground Wine Tasting is something else and if you get the chance - I recommend you do this tour organised by the hotel. You will always feel like you have special attention given there are only 15 lodges available here but truly - the staff go above and beyond to cater and attend to your every whim (and sometimes get you out of a pickle). From making sure the day lounge was made into a bed for one of us snorers to retreat to at night - to helping us find last minute transportation when our uber did not show up to take us back to the airport, we were grateful for the wonderful staff. A special mention to Darcy, Maddie, Ian, Pi, Esther and Deborah. You have left us with special memories and we thank you!"
